[0018] Overview of Mobile Devices

[0019] In some implementations, the mobile device 100 includes a touch-sensitive display 102 . The touch-sensitive display 102 may implement liquid crystal display (LCD) technology, light emitting polymer display (LPD) technology, or other display technologies. Touch-sensitive display 102 is sensitive to tactile and / or tactile contact with a user.

Abstract

Remote access management for a mobile device includes an activation process where a digitally signed activation record is created by a remote activation service and provided to the mobile device. The activation record is used to determine an activation state for the mobile device. Upon activation, a security process running on the mobile device enforces a security policy regarding remote access to the mobile device.

Background technique [0004] Conventional mobile devices are usually used to execute specific applications. For example, a mobile phone provides telephone service, a personal digital assistant (PDA) provides a means for organizing addresses, contacts and notes, a media player plays content, an e-mail device provides e-mail communication, and so on. Modern mobile devices can include two or more of these applications. Due to the size constraints of typical mobile devices, such mobile devices may need to rely on network or other remote services to support these various applications. ...
